Proposes a change to city law: Allow settlement of the lawsuit filed by David M.
Ordinance authorizing settlement of the lawsuit filed by David M. Kennedy-Phelps against the City and County of San Francisco for $50,000; the lawsuit was filed on November 22, 2024, in San Francisco Superior Court, Case No. CGC-24-620022; entitled David M. Kennedy-Phelps v. City and County of San Francisco, et al.; the lawsuit involves alleged personal injury from a vehicle collision.
How it got here
This legislation originated from a lawsuit settlement involving a personal injury claim against the City and County of San Francisco.
David M. Kennedy-Phelps filed a lawsuit against the City and County of San Francisco in San Francisco Superior Court, alleging personal injury from a vehicle collision.
The City Attorney recommended settling the lawsuit for $50,000, as authorized by Charter Section 6.102(5).
The ordinance authorizing the settlement was received from the City Attorney's office.
The ordinance was received and assigned to the Government Audit and Oversight Committee for further consideration.
The committee is scheduled to hear the ordinance regarding the settlement of the lawsuit.
